Possible Causes of Water Damage to Wood Floors
One of the primary causes of water damage to hardwood floors in Wellston is plumbing failures. Burst or leaking pipes can lead to a significant amount of water seeping into your flooring, especially if the leak goes unnoticed for an extended period. Flooding from heavy rains or nearby natural bodies of water can also result in the immersion of your flooring, especially if your property has any drainage issues or foundation vulnerabilities.
Additionally, roof leaks or faulty appliances like washing machines or dishwashers can cause water to accumulate on or beneath the surface of your wood floors. High humidity and improper ventilation can also contribute to moisture buildup, leading to persistent dampness that weakens the wood and encourages mold growth. What should I do immediately after water damage occurs to my wood floors?
It’s crucial to act quickly by shutting off the water source if possible and removing any standing water. Contact our experts immediately for professional assessment and drying. Prompt action helps prevent long-term damage and mold growth.
Can water-damaged hardwood floors be fully restored?
In many cases, yes, especially if we respond swiftly. Our restoration process can often salvage and refinish your hardwood floors, reversing warping, staining, and damage caused by water intrusion.
